Google Adsense Referral Programs New Updates
Well as Google has announced previously in their blog that all the referral program outside North America, Latin America, and Japan will be closed for the publishers. Because of this many bloggers were disappointed and why not because this changes were never logical. Due to so many feedbacks by publisher they made some changes which would be consider as logical changes.
The New Changes Are As Follows:
AdSense Referral Program:
The changes to referrals promoting AdSense will now depend on where your users are located, regardless of your location as a publisher. You’ll earn $100 for every user you refer to AdSense who is located in North America, Latin America or Japan when they generate $100 in AdSense revenue within 180 days and they remove all payment holds. You’ll no longer be paid for users you refer who are located elsewhere. These changes will go into effect the last week of January.
Google Pack Referral Program:
Currently, you can earn up to $2 when a user downloads and runs Google Pack for the first time after being referred through your link or button. Starting the third week of February, each successful Pack referral will earn up to $1. This change will apply to all referrals for Google Pack and is independent of user location or publisher location.
Firefox Referral Program:
We’ll also be reducing payments for Firefox referrals from China during the third week of February. This specific referral payment change will only affect installations from users in China. Again, this is independent of your location as a publisher.
